Illinois officials say they’ve expunged 500,000 cannabis convictions

Gov. J.B. Pritzker pardoned 9,210 low-level marijuana convictions. Illinois police erased 492,000 others.

New Jersey adult-use marijuana bill awaits governor’s signature

New Jersey lawmakers passed a measure Thursday setting up a recreational marijuana marketplace, sending the legislation to Democratic Gov. Phil Murphy, who is expected to sign the bill.  The Democrat-led Assembly and Senate passed the bill during …

History made: US House of Representatives votes to end federal marijuana prohibition

The MORE Act now goes to the Senate, where it’s expected to be blocked by majority leader Mitch McConnell.
